Chandigarh, April 7, 2022: Dietician Shreya's NGO Aaharika, which is providing free healthy and nutritious food to the underprivileged for the last five years, submitted a memorandum to the Haryana CM Manohar Lal Khattar for pushing 'Millet Kranti'

Being a nutritionist and health practitioner, Millet Girl Shreya strongly believes that the  International Year of Millets 2023 will be celebrated by 70 countries worldwide.
"It’s time for Millet Kranti after Green Revolution in 1960 and white revolution in 1970. There are two important aspects to millet revolution; first depleting water level and less fertile soil due to contemporary farming cycles of wheat and rice. So cultivation of millets will result in fertile soil and less water requirement for millet crop. And second, being health professional and dealing with Non Communicable diseases Millets as staple food are strongly recommended”, said Shreya.
Meanwhile, the memorandum stated that there is only one Millets Research Institute situated at Hyderabad in India and a similar institute will prove a boon to Haryana farmers growing millets.
